In order to determine which treatment effects differ significantly from others, we need to make pairwise comparisons between all possible pairs of treatment groups. Let's consider an example with four treatment groups labeled A, B, C, and D.
To determine which treatment effects differ significantly from others, we need to compare the mean scores of each treatment group with the mean scores of every other treatment group. This means we need to make the following pairwise comparisons:
A vs B
A vs C
A vs D
B vs C
B vs D
C vs D
Therefore, there are 6 pairwise comparisons that need to be made in order to gain a complete understanding of which treatment effects differ significantly from others.
It's worth noting that when making multiple pairwise comparisons, there is an increased risk of making a Type I error (i.e., rejecting the null hypothesis when it is actually true) due to the multiple testing problem. To control for this, researchers may choose to adjust the significance level or use methods such as the Bonferroni correction to adjust the p-values of the individual tests.

Find the points on the ellipse 5x2 + y2 = 5 that are farthest away from the point (1, 0).
The points on the ellipse 5x² + y² = 5 that are farthest away from (1, 0) are (-0.25, ±√4.6875).
The square of the distance from a point on the ellipse to the point (1, 0) is ...
d^2 = (x -1)^2 +y^2
Using the equation of the ellipse to write an expression for y^2, we have ...
d^2 = (x -1)^2 +5 -5x^2
d^2 = -4x^2 -2x +6
The expression on the right is that of a downward-opening parabola with ...
a = -4, b = -2, c = 6
The maximum is located at ...
x = -b/(2a) = -(-2)/(2(-4)) = -1/4
The value of y there is ...
y^2 = 5 -5(-1/4)^2 = 4 11/16
y = √4.6875
Hence the points on the ellipse farthest from (1, 0) are (-0.25,±√4.6875).

suppose that a classroom has 4 light bulbs. the probability that each individual light bulbs work is 0.6. suppose that each light bulb works independently of the other light bulbs. what is the probability that none of the 4 light bulbs work?
The probability that none of the 4 light bulbs work is 2.56%.
As per the given information, the probability that an individual light bulb works is 0.6.
Therefore, the probability that it does not work (i.e., fails) is:
1 - 0.6 = 0.4
Since each light bulb works independently of the other light bulbs, the probability that none of the 4 light bulbs work is the product of the individual probabilities that each light bulb fails.
Calculated as,
P(none work) = P(first fails) × P(second fails) × P(third fails) × P(fourth fails)
P(none work) = 0.4 × 0.4 × 0.4 × 0.4
P(none work) = 0.0256
Therefore, the probability that none of the 4 light bulbs work is 0.0256 or approximately 2.56%.
